When dining in Keerom, embracing local customs will enhance your experience. It's common to eat with the right hand, though utensils are widely available. Tipping is not a mandatory practice in most local eateries, but rounding up the bill or leaving a small amount for exceptional service is appreciated. Meal times are generally similar to other parts of Indonesia, with lunch being the main meal of the day, typically between 12 PM and 2 PM. Being open to trying new dishes and respecting the local way of eating will be greatly appreciated by your hosts.

Local Etiquette & Safety in Keerom

Understanding local customs is key to a respectful and smooth visit to Keerom. As in much of Indonesia, politeness and humility are highly valued. When interacting with locals, a gentle demeanour and a smile go a long way. It's customary to use your right hand for giving and receiving items, including food and money, as the left hand is sometimes considered unclean. Dress modestly, especially when visiting religious sites or more traditional villages, covering shoulders and knees to show respect for local sensibilities.

Navigating areas like Senggeh Airport (SEH) or near landmarks such as Apotek keerom farma 2 requires awareness of local norms. While airports generally have standardized procedures, observing local queues and respecting personal space is important. Photography of individuals, especially in more remote areas, should always be done with permission. Be mindful of any local customs or rules that may be posted or communicated by guides, ensuring your actions are respectful of the community and its traditions.

Safety in Keerom is generally good, with petty crime being uncommon in most areas. However, as with any travel, it's wise to take precautions. Keep your valuables secure and avoid displaying large amounts of cash. For transportation, while ride-hailing apps might have limited availability in more remote parts of Keerom, local taxis and motorcycle taxis ('ojek') are common. It's advisable to agree on a fare before starting your journey. For navigation, offline map applications can be very useful in areas with spotty internet connectivity.

For Filipino travellers, it's important to know emergency contact information. In Indonesia, the general emergency number is 112. For specific assistance, the Philippine Embassy in Jakarta is the primary point of contact, though it's advisable to check for any consular services or honorary consulates closer to the Papua region if available. Carrying travel insurance is highly recommended for any international trip, providing coverage for medical emergencies and unforeseen events, ensuring peace of mind during your stay in Keerom.

Travel Guide to Keerom

Reaching Keerom from the Philippines typically involves flights from major hubs like Manila (MNL) or Cebu (CEB), with connections usually made in major Indonesian cities such as Jakarta or Denpasar. Direct flights are rare, and the journey can take anywhere from 12 to 20 hours or more, depending on layovers. The closest airport serving Keerom is Senggeh Airport (SEH). While flight prices fluctuate, budget around ₱ 20,000 to ₱ 40,000 for a round trip, depending on the season and how far in advance you book flight tickets.

Getting around Keerom and its surrounding areas primarily relies on local transport. Options include 'ojek' (motorcycle taxis) for shorter distances, which are affordable and readily available. For longer distances or group travel, hiring a car with a driver is a common and practical choice, though it will be more expensive. Public buses and minivans ('angkot') operate on set routes but can be crowded and may not be the most convenient for tourists unfamiliar with the system. Agreeing on fares beforehand is always recommended.

The best time to visit Keerom is generally during the d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, the weather is more favourable for outdoor activities and exploration, with less rainfall. While Keerom doesn't experience extreme temperature fluctuations, the dry season offers more predictable conditions. This period might coincide with some international holiday seasons, potentially leading to slightly higher prices and more visitors, though Keerom remains relatively uncrowded compared to mainstream Indonesian destinations.

Before departing for Keerom, ensure you have your essential travel documents in order.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R). While major hotels might accept credit cards, it's advisable to carry sufficient cash, especially for smaller towns and local markets. Consider pur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ival for easier communication and data access. Essential apps to download include offline maps, a translation app, and potentially ride-hailing apps if available in the region. Always check the latest travel advisories from your country's foreign affairs department.

Visa Information for Indonesia (Keerom)

For Philippine passport holders planning to visit Indonesia, including the Keerom region, a visa-on-arrival or visa-free entry is typically available for short tourist stays. As of recent regulations, Filipino citizens can usually enter Indonesia for tourism purposes for up to 30 days without a visa, provided their passport is valid for at least six months beyond their intended stay and they possess a confirmed onward or return ticket. It is crucial to verify the latest entry requirements with the Indonesian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ines before your travel dates, as policies can change.

The application process for a visa on arrival, if required, or for extending a stay, involves presenting your passport and potentially other documents at the immigration counter. While visa-free entry for Filipinos is common for short stays, it's always prudent to confirm the exact duration and any specific conditions. Ensure your passport has sufficient blank pages for entry and exit stamps. The Philippine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) also requires passports to be valid for at least six months from the date of entry into Indonesia.

Given that immigration policies are subject to change, it is strongly recommended that all travellers, including those from the Philippines, verify the most current visa regulations directly with the official immigration authorities of Indonesia or the Indonesian Embassy in the Philippines well in advance of booking any flights or accommodation. Confirming your entry status before making travel arrangements will prevent any last-minute complications and ensure a smooth journey to Keerom and other parts of Indonesia.
